## Broker Upgrade Basics

We run Pondrel as the message broker for the Skiffworks platform. Upgrades happen quarterly, one node at a time, consumers drained first. Never skip a minor version. Always snapshot queue state before touching a node, and verify replication lag is zero afterward. Rollbacks are supported only within the same major version. New folks shadow one upgrade before running one. The step-by-step upgrade checklist lives here.

dashboard of yajeg-tawif = https://grafana.nelvrohq.internal/settings/deploy/board/spaces/c3dc1ffa01438d1d

## Who to ping about GiftNote

Welcome aboard! GiftNote is our donation-receipt mailer for the Larchfield Fund. Template tweaks go to the comms folks; delivery failures and bounce weirdness go to the platform crew. Don't push template changes on Fridays — receipts batch over the weekend. For anything GiftNote-related, start with the address below.

billing contact of kaweg-tajeg = drudor.lamion.oliath@torvalabs.test

## Launch Plan: Ferrow One (Managers Only)

Sales leads: Ferrow One launches in the Caldmere region first, with a staged rollout over six weeks. Pricing tiers are final; discounting above 10% requires director sign-off. Training materials ship Friday via the Orvell portal. Channel partners are briefed the week before launch, not earlier. The strategic reasoning behind this sequencing appears in the confidential note below.

management briefing: The renewal with Zoraelax Group closes at $10 million a year, 15 percent below the last contract. Project Ralael slips by six weeks because of the audit delay.